Dimapur, Nov. 4 (EMN): As part of its civic action programme, Assam Rifles conducted medical and immunisation camps, constructed waiting shed and recreation hall in various districts of the state.

A defence release on Wednesday stated that Jalukie battalion of the Assam Rifles, in collaboration with PHC Ahthibung, conducted medical and immunisation camp at Vonkithem on November 1. It informed that the medical team provided medical check- up and immunisation to the villagers of Vonkithem, Phaijol and New Chamcha village and provided necessary medicine.

The villagers were briefed about the various health and hygiene precautions to be taken during the Covid-19 crisis. A total of 152 villagers were benefited from the medical and immunisation camp.

In a separate programme, Dimapur battalion constructed a waiting shed at Herbert Spencer School located at North Angami Colony in Dimapur district. It was constructed at an approximate cost of INR 1.5 lakh and was handed over to the school in the presence of the village GB and chairman on November 2.

It stated that the school authority has extended gratitude and lauded the efforts of Assam Rifles.

In another programme, Mon battalion of the Assam Rifles constructed a recreation hall at Shalom Kids School Foundation and handed over to the school authority. The report stated that the school authority has appreciated the efforts of Assam Rifles.
